Abstract
Implant devices described herein may be adapted to communicate with other devices via an antenna array. The antenna array may be configured to minimize radiation to surrounding tissue and/or maximize signal power in a direction of device(s) with which the implant device communicates.

18. A microchip controller couplable to an implant device that is implantable inside an organism and adapted to wirelessly communicate via an antenna array with a device external to the implant device, the antenna array comprising two or more individual antenna elements, the microchip controller comprising:
-
a Radio Frequency (RF) transceiver that includes a send path and a receive path, wherein the RF transceiver send path is configured to convert implant device data into RF signals, and to transmit RF signals via the antenna array to the device external to the implant device, and wherein the RF transceiver receive path is configured to convert RF signals received from the antenna array into data adapted for consumption by the implant device; and wherein the RF transceiver send path is configured to adjust phase of RF signals transmitted by each of the individual antenna elements in the antenna array to adjust a strongest signal direction of transmitted RF signals. - View Dependent Claims (19, 20, 21, 22, 23, 24, 25, 26, 27, 28, 29, 30, 31, 32, 33)
